Account recovery, consent-banner edition. If you get locked out of the Mossbridge rollout console mid-deploy (happens more than you'd think — the session store resets when the banner config flips regions), don't panic and don't re-trigger the rollout. Pause the flag in Fernwick first, then recover your account through the break-glass flow. It'll ask for the team recovery phrase before letting you back in. Type the passphrase below exactly as written.

unlock words, taguf-yafop: quenwyn-druox

Ticket #4471 — Locked config vault, SnackRoute restock planner

Welcome aboard. The SnackRoute vault locked itself after three failed unlock attempts during last night's deploy, so the restock planner cannot read route weights for the Calderwood depot machines. Please do not retry unlocks manually; that extends the lockout. Instead, follow the recovery flow in the runbook, step 6, and verify the audit log afterward. To reopen the vault, enter the recovery passphrase exactly as shown below.

recovery phrase for fawif-tajeg: norael-aldmir-casir-brivan-ulaion

# Linting rules for SQL files (read this before touching anything)
#
# Welcome aboard! The Tarnbrook linter treats our SQL a bit differently
# than you might expect: migrations get the strict ruleset, ad-hoc
# analytics queries in /scratch get the lenient one. Don't "fix" that,
# it's deliberate — the Osprey Hollow team burned a week learning why.
# If the linter feels too slow or too noisy, adjust the thresholds
# rather than disabling rules. The tunable limits are as follows.

limits module of kawef-hawef:
TIERS = {
    "belax": 967,
    "gorvan": 210,
    "ulair": 473,
}

Internal Memo — Delay to Project Lanternwell

To the heads of department: Project Lanternwell, our internal logistics platform rebuild at Dunmore Fabrication, will slip by one quarter. The delay stems from integration testing failures and the reassignment of two engineers to urgent client work. Budget impact is contained within contingency. Revised milestones will circulate next week. The sensitive planning context for this schedule change is noted below.

confidential, kagup-bafog: Fraaxax Group is in early talks to buy Soroxox Group for about $343.8 million. The Olidor launch date is June 14, and nothing goes to the press before then. Legal wants the Aldmirek Logistics term sheet signed before July 23.